  • More than 3.5 million children use prescription stimulants such as Ritalin, Concerta and Adderall.
  • A recent survey found that 6.8 percent of drivers, mostly under age 35, who were involved in accidents tested positive for THC; alcohol levels above the legal limit were found in 21 percent of such drivers.
  • Medications which should not be consumed with alcohol due to dangerous drug interaction include aspirin, acetaminophen, cold and allergy medicine, cough syrup, sleeping pills, pain medication and anxiety or depression medicine.

Substance Abuse Treatment Services

Substance abuse treatment services can be obtained in a number of settings and with different rehab lengths and plans to suit the varying demands of clients with any kind of and amount of addiction. With both short and long term and both inpatient and residential centers now being paid by many insurance plans, there's no need to postpone getting substance abuse treatment services for anyone who needs it.

Outpatient

Outpatient services are on the lower end of the spectrum of rehab services with regards to level of care, since the individual can preserve their lifestyle in lots of ways without the commitment of needing to remain in a rehab center while undergoing treatment services. While this may appear ideal it may not provide the required change of atmosphere than a lot of people in recovery have to have to experience a successful rehabilitation.

Residential Long-Term Treatment (More Than 30 Days)

Residential long-term rehab, which lasts for longer than 30 days, is definitely an option that delivers the commensurate intensity of care and appropriate environment for anyone struggling with a life threatening addiction and dependency problem. Because people will stay in the residential long-term rehab program for up to 3-6 months and even longer in some cases, these kinds of centers offer all the amenities needed to help client's stay as comfortable and amenable as it could possibly be while also delivering high quality rehabilitation to enable them to overcome their addiction once and for all.

Criminal Justice Clients

Criminal justice clients find their way into treatment as part of a court order in order to meet part of their sentencing for a drug offense. Criminal justice clients in alcohol and drug rehabilitation frequently receive reduced penalties, fines etc. when being cooperative with alcohol and drug rehabilitation specifications enforced on them in sentencing especially of course when successfully completing a drug rehab center.

ASL or Other Assistance for Hearing Impaired

The hearing impaired can often be prone to alcoholism and drug abuse due to problems that their impairment impose on them. While discovery of the issue can often be difficult among the hearing impaired, you'll find ASL and also other assistance services available for them when drug abuse treatment is needed. Besides ASL, such services may include assistive listening equipment and captioned video resources so that deaf and hearing impaired individuals are obtaining the support they need in alcohol and drug rehabilitation.

Self Payment

Self Payment is required when someone's insurance isn't going to pay for the entire cost of treatment or will only cover some of it. In these situations, it may seem like a drawback but people actually have a great deal of leverage simply because they can choose whichever program they would like without the restrictions from health insurers that so many individuals encounter. Likewise, treatment centers will usually provide payment assistance for individuals whose only choice is self payment to enable them to get into treatment.

Medicaid

Some treatment centers accept Medicaid if the individual cannot self pay or present any other type of private health insurance. Medicaid might pay for outpatient and short-term rehab inside a limited amount of facilities, and in this case individuals might want to investigate the self pay alternative and drum up any resources they are able to to fund a more quality treatment facility which will get better results, say for example a long-term residential alcohol and drug rehab program.

State Financed Insurance (Other Than Medicaid)

State financed insurance other than Medicaid can be used to cover the expense of drug rehabilitation if other kinds of insurance or self payment aren't a possibility. If someone doesn't have private insurance and doesn't yet know whether they may qualify for state insurance, they can consult their Social Services office within their area to ascertain if they are and then apply. The majority of state financed insurance will handle both outpatient and inpatient treatment, but usually only within the state which provides the insurance.

Private Health Insurance

Depending on which program you are covered by, all private medical insurance plans typically cover some sort of drug and alcohol rehab service which range from outpatient treatment to inpatient or residential drug and alcohol treatment centers. Individuals could have to take part in a drug and alcohol rehab facility which is in their network of providers and there could be other limitations such as how long their stay in rehabilitation is covered. Individuals can pick a quality facility they like and consult with a rehabilitation counselor to find out if their insurance will handle it.

Military Insurance (E.G., Va, Tricare)

Military insurance such as VA and Tricare does cover the expenses of particular drug abuse rehabilitation solutions. Detoxification services, outpatient and inpatient centers in addition to partial hospitalization are all paid for by military insurance, although military members may require pre-authorization in which case they can liaise with their VA or Tricare representative. There could be some limitations as to how much time a stay in inpatient drug rehabilitation is permitted, and every one of these questions can be answered before you start rehab so that it is clear just how long and individual can remain in the rehab facility of choice.
